On Monday, 25 August, during BET’s “106 & Park” a segment of the show had a guest host, Karreuche Tran, who made a joke about Blue Ivy’s uncombed natural hair.
Immediately after the show aired, Beyoncé fans flocked to Twitter to attack Karrueche for telling the inappropriate joke.
However, Karreuche said she was only reading the teleprompter and the producers changed the script 10 minutes beforehand without her knowledge.
But that didn’t stop the good folks of beyhive from lashing out at Chris Brown’s girlfriend. They really went after her on social media until BET had to man-up and take the blame.
Stephen Hill, BET’s president of Music Programming, announced via a series of tweet explaining that she didn’t write the joke.
Hill also apologized to Beyoncé and Jay Z and said the producers who wrote the joke would be appropriately disciplined.
Meanwhile, it has been announced that the show, 106 & Park will be off-the-air for the remainder of the week, which has prompted many to speculate that the temporary hiatus was as a result of the Blue ivy joke goof, and ultimately, the power of Beyonce and her die-hard fans.
